Gearbox’s Project 1v1 is a fast, fluid, and furiously fun arena shooter

By Geoffrey Tim
June 13, 2018
in :  Gaming
0

While Gearbox didn’t show off Borderlands in any guide, we did get to go hands on with its new shooter. Called Project 1v1, it does – as its name suggests – pit two players against each other. Reminiscent of games like Quake Arena and Unreal Tournament, it’s a fast-paced arena shooter with a focus on skill.

Hitman 2 doesn’t change much of its superb formula, but it doesn’t need to

By Darryn Bonthuys
June 13, 2018
in :  Gaming
0

Agent 47 was a MacGuyver of murder whose trip around the world saw numerous dodgy individuals murdered in increasingly bizarre and creative ways. It’s that creativity which has been the foundation of the entire Hitman franchise, a fact that Hitman 2 wastes no time in reminding you of when you step back into the Italian loafers of 47 as he starts a new contract.
